Just to be sure, Bill, Jake Tapper of CNN contradicts your narrative that the cancellation came from the bottom-up ...

Why was Jimmy Kimmel's show pulled? Jake Tapper says, 'follow the money' (CNN, YouTube short)

Tapper says that the FCC chair, Brendan Carr, went on the show of RuZZian propagandist Benny Johnson and called on local TV stations to drop Kimmel. That interview was posted on Wednesday at 1:01 PM.

Within hours, Nexstar announces that their stations will pre-empt Jimmy Kimmel.

The timing matters, Bill, because now you can't pretend that the FCC was merely reacting to actions that the local stations supposedly took on their own behalf. There was no sign that there'd be a mass pre-emption of Kimmel's show until the order came from up top.

(And just a reminder, Nexstar is trying to get FCC approval for a huge billion dollar merger, so of course they are going to bend the knee and kiss the ring. Anything to please the regulators.)
